Article Overview
This article explains selected ICD-10-CM updates tied to social determinants of health, with emphasis on housing, food access, and related documentation guidance. It is aimed at coding professionals and clinical documentation teams who need to understand what changed for the 2022 revision cycle and how the updated ICD-10-CM guidance affects record review and reporting practices.
Why This Topic Matters
The changes discussed affect how social and environmental factors are represented in coded data and documented in the medical record. That makes the article relevant to coders, auditors, and clinicians working with ICD-10-CM guidance, evaluation and management documentation, and SDoH-related charting.
Article Sections
-
Housing Insecurity
This section covers ICD-10-CM updates related to housing instability and homelessness within the SDoH context. It also discusses related CDC changes to the housing and economic circumstances category.
-
Food Insecurity
This section addresses ICD-10-CM updates related to lack of adequate food and other food-access concerns. It also references related terminology changes and associated documentation context.
-
Keep Current on New Z-Code Guidelines
This section summarizes updated ICD-10-CM guidance for documenting social determinants of health. It focuses on source documentation, record inclusion, and the role of various clinicians in supporting coded information.
